Conceptualization πŸ€”πŸ§

Before filming even begins, it’s important to have a solid concept that aligns with the song’s lyrics and overall vibe. The music video team will work closely with the artist to fully understand the message behind the music and brainstorm ideas that can visually communicate this message.

πŸ’‘ Tip: Don’t be afraid to think outside the box and push boundaries with the concept. Remember, a memorable music video tells a unique story that stands out from the rest.

Storyboarding πŸ“πŸŽ₯

Once the concept has been solidified, it’s time to develop a detailed storyboard and shot list. This helps ensure that each scene is planned out meticulously and nothing important is left out during the shoot.

πŸ“Œ Tip: Collaborate with the entire creative team when storyboarding. This includes the director, cinematographer, and set designers.

Casting πŸ‘₯🎭

Choosing the right talent for a music video can make or break the overall visual experience. From lead roles to extras, each casting decision must fit the vision of the concept.

πŸ‘ Tip: Don’t only focus on looks and talent. Make sure each actor has a personality that meshes well with the overall vibe and message of the music.

Location Scouting πŸ“πŸŽ¬

The right location can add immense depth and emotion to a music video. Before filming begins, the creative team will scout different locations that perfectly fit the concept and overall message of the song.

πŸŒ… Tip: Choose locations that help tell the story and add to the overall vibe of the music video. Don’t compromise on the location just because it’s convenient or fits the budget.

Lighting and Cinematography πŸ”¦πŸ“Ή

Lighting and cinematography are key components in creating a compelling music video narrative. Each shot must be carefully lit and framed to showcase the emotion and mood of the scene.

πŸŽ₯ Tip: Don’t be afraid to experiment with different lighting techniques. This can add visual interest and help establish the overall aesthetic of the music video.

Post-Production πŸ–₯οΈπŸ”¨

Finally, post-production is where all the pieces come together. Editing, color grading, and visual effects can add the final touches to the music video, giving it a polished look.

πŸ’» Tip: Work closely with the creative team during post-production. This is where the overall vision comes to life, and every small detail matters.
